Web Developer
Role details
Job location
Tech stack
Job description
As a key member of the development function, you will work across both front-end and back-end technologies, contributing to the design, build and optimisation of web applications, data integrations and reporting solutions. You will collaborate closely with internal stakeholders to deliver robust, scalable and user-centred products.
Requirements
We are seeking a skilled Full-Stack Web Developer to join our clients growing technical team. This role is ideal for someone who thrives in a dynamic environment, takes a proactive approach to problem-solving, and is passionate about building high-performing digital experiences with a mobile-first mindset., * Strong expertise in MVC, HTML5, CSS3, and responsive design.
- Experience with CSS preprocessors such as SASS or LESS.
- Proficient with server-side languages including .NET, C#, MVC, Liquid and Python.
- Solid understanding of SQL Server, data modelling, cleansing and dataset preparation.
- Experience supporting or developing Power BI dashboards and data visualisations.
- Familiarity with APIs, automation tools and AI/ML-driven platforms.
- Strong JavaScript and jQuery skills, including asynchronous handling and AJAX.
- Knowledge of version control tools such as Azure DevOps.
- Understanding of UX principles across online and mobile contexts.
- Excellent communication skills and a systematic, organised approach to work.
If you're driven, detail-oriented and eager to make an impact, we'd love to hear from you.